convert pdf to image in c#.net : Convert locked pdf to word online SDK software service wpf winforms windows dnn import_export10-part106

Importing Scientific Data Files
User-Defined
You can import a subset of the Grid data set by specifying user-defined
subsetting parameters.
When specifying user-defined parameters, you must first specify whether you
are subsetting along a dimension or by field. Select the dimension or field by
name using the Dimension or Field Name menu. Dimension names are
prefixed with the characters
DIM:
.
Once you specify the dimension or field, you use Min and Max to specify
the range of values that you want to import. For dimensions, Min and Max
represent a range of elements. For fields, Min and Max represent a range
of values.
HDF-EOS Point Data. HDF-EOS Point data sets are tables. You can import
asubset of an HDF-EOS Point data set by specifying field names and level.
Optionally, you can refine the subsetting by specifying the rangeof records you
want to import, by defining a rectangular area, or by specifying a time period.
For information about specifying a rectangular area, see Geographic Box on
page 83. For information about subsetting by time, see Time on page 86.
2-87
Convert locked pdf to word online - C# PDF Digital Signature Library: add, remove, update PDF digital signatures in C#.net, ASP.NET, MVC, WPF
Help to Improve the Security of Your PDF File by Adding Digital Signatures
pdf password security; add security to pdf document
Convert locked pdf to word online - VB.NET PDF Digital Signature Library: add, remove, update PDF digital signatures in vb.net, ASP.NET, MVC, WPF
Guide VB.NET Programmers to Improve the Security of Your PDF File by Adding Digital Signatures
pdf password encryption; change security settings pdf
2
Importing Data
HDF-EOS Swath Data. HDF-EOS Swath data is data that is produced by
asatellite as it traces a path over the earth. This path is called its ground
track. The sensor aboard the satellite takes a series of scans perpendicular to
the ground track. Swath data can also include a vertical measure as a third
dimension. For example, this vertical dimension can represent the height
above the Earth of the sensor.
The HDF Import Tool supports the following mutually exclusive subsetting
options for Swath data:
To access these options, click the
Subsetting method
menu in the
Importing and Subsetting pane.



2-88
C# PDF Page Extract Library: copy, paste, cut PDF pages in C#.net
though they are using different types of word processors. Besides, the capacity to be locked against editing or processing by others makes PDF file become
pdf file security; copy locked pdf
C# Word - Extract or Copy Pages from Word File in C#.NET
C#.NET convert PDF to text, C#.NET convert PDF to images VB.NET How-to, VB.NET PDF, VB.NET Word Besides, the capacity to be locked against editing or processing
decrypt a pdf; pdf password unlock
Importing Scientific Data Files
Direct Index
You can import a subset of an HDF-EOS Swath data set by specifying the
location, range, and number of values to be read along each dimension.
Each row represents a dimension in the data set and each column represents
these subsetting parameters:
• Start — Specifies the position on the dimension to begin reading. The
default value is 1, which starts reading at the first element of each
dimension. The values specified must not exceed the size of the relevant
dimension of the data set.
• Increment — Specifies the interval between the values to read. The
default value is 1, which reads every element of the data set.
• Length — Specifies how much data to read along each dimension. The
default value is the length of the dimension, which causes all the data to
be read.
Geographic Box
You can import a subset of an HDF-EOS Swath data set by specifying the
rectangular area of the grid that you are interested in and by specifying the
selection Mode.
2-89
C# PowerPoint - Extract or Copy PowerPoint Pages from PowerPoint
PDF, VB.NET delete PDF pages, VB.NET convert PDF to SVG. VB.NET How-to, VB.NET PDF, VB.NET Word Besides, the capacity to be locked against editing or processing
decrypt pdf file online; decrypt pdf password
VB.NET Word: Extract Text from Microsoft Word Document in VB.NET
Word documents are often locked as static images and the through VB.NET programming, convert Word document to & profession imaging controls, PDF document, tiff
decrypt a pdf file online; secure pdf remove
2
Importing Data
You define the rectangular area by specifying two points that specify two
corners of the box:
• Corner 1 — Specify longitude and latitude values in decimal degrees.
Typically, Corner 1 is the upper-left corner of the box.
• Corner 2 — Specify longitude and latitude values in decimal degrees.
Typically, Corner 2 is the lower-right corner of the box.
You specify the selection mode by choosing the type of Cross Track
Inclusion and the Geolocation mode. The Cross Track Inclusion value
determines how much of the area of the geographic box that you define must
fall within the boundaries of the swath.
Select from these values:
• AnyPoint — Any part of the box overlaps with the swath.
• Midpoint — At least half of the box overlaps with the swath.
• Endpoint — All of the area defined by the box overlaps with the swath.
The Geolocation Mode value specifies whether geolocation fields and data
must be in the same swath.
2-90
C# Excel - Extract or Copy Excel Pages to Excel File in C#.NET
C#.NET convert PDF to text, C#.NET convert PDF to images VB.NET How-to, VB.NET PDF, VB.NET Word Besides, the capacity to be locked against editing or processing
pdf security password; convert locked pdf to word doc
Importing Scientific Data Files
Select from these values:
• Internal — Geolocation fields and data fields must be in the same swath.
• External — Geolocation fields and data fields can be in different swaths.
Time
You can optionally also subset swath data by specifying a time period. The
units used (hours, minutes, seconds) to specify the time are defined by the
data set
User-Defined
You can optionally also subset a swath data set by specifying user-defined
parameters.
When specifying user-defined parameters, you must first specify whether you
are subsetting along a dimension or by field. Select the dimension or field by
2-91
2
Importing Data
name using the Dimension or Field Name menu. Dimension names are
prefixed with the characters
DIM:
.
Once you specify the dimension or field, you use Min and Max to specify
the range of values that you want to import. For dimensions, Min and Max
represent a range of elements. For fields, Min and Max represent a range
of values.
HDF Raster Image Data. For 8-bit HDF raster image data, you can specify
the colormap.
Using the MATLAB HDF4 High-Level Functions
To import data from an HDF or HDF-EOS file, you can use the MATLAB
HDF4 high-level function
hdfread
. The
hdfread
function provides a
programmatic way to import data from an HDF4 or HDF-EOS file that still
hides many of the details that you need to know if you use the low-level HDF
functions, described in “Using the HDF4 Low-Level Functions” on page 2-96.
You can also import HDF4 data using an interactive GUI, described in “Using
the HDF Import Tool” on page 2-74.
This section describes these high-level MATLAB HDF functions, including
• “Using hdfinfo to Get Information About an HDF4 File” on page 2-92
• “Using hdfread to Import Data from an HDF4 File” on page 2-93
To export data to an HDF4 file, you must use the MATLAB HDF4 low-level
functions.
Using hdfinfo to Get Information About an HDF4 File. To get
information about the contents of an HDF4 file, use the
hdfinfo
function.
The
hdfinfo
function returns a structure that contains information about the
file and the data in the file.
Note You can also use the HDF Import Tool to get information about the
contents of an HDF4 file. See “Using the HDF Import Tool” on page 2-74
for more information.
2-92
Importing Scientific Data Files
This example returns information about a sample HDF4 file included with
MATLAB:
info = hdfinfo('example.hdf')
info =
Filename: 'matlabroot\example.hdf'
Attributes: [1x2 struct]
Vgroup: [1x1 struct]
SDS: [1x1 struct]
Vdata: [1x1 struct]
To get information about the data sets stored in the file, look at the
SDS
field.
Using hdfread to Import Data from an HDF4 File. To use the
hdfread
function, you must specify the data set that you want to read. You can specify
the filename and the data set name as arguments, or you can specify a
structure returned by the
hdfinfo
function that contains this information.
The following example shows both methods. For information about how to
import a subset of the data in a data set, see Reading a Subset of the Data in
aData Set on page 95.
1
Determine the names of data sets in the HDF4 file, using the
hdfinfo
function.
info = hdfinfo('example.hdf')
info =
Filename: 'matlabroot\example.hdf'
Attributes: [1x2 struct]
Vgroup: [1x1 struct]
SDS: [1x1 struct]
Vdata: [1x1 struct]
To determine the names and other information about the data sets in the file,
look at the contents of the
SDS
field. The
Name
field in the SDS structure
gives the name of the data set.
dsets = info.SDS
2-93
2
Importing Data
dsets =
Filename: 'example.hdf'
Type: 'Scientific Data Set'
Name: 'Example SDS'
Rank: 2
DataType: 'int16'
Attributes: []
Dims: [2x1 struct]
Label: {}
Description: {}
Index: 0
2
Read the data set from the HDF4 file, using the
hdfread
function. Specify the
name of the data set as a parameter to the function. Note that the data set
name is case sensitive. This example returns a 16-by-5 array:
dset = hdfread('example.hdf', 'Example SDS')
dset =
3
4
5
6
7
4
5
6
7
8
5
6
7
8
9
6
7
8
9
10
7
8
9
10
11
8
9
10
11
12
9
10
11
12
13
10
11
12
13
14
11
12
13
14
15
12
13
14
15
16
13
14
15
16
17
14
15
16
17
18
15
16
17
18
19
16
17
18
19
20
17
18
19
20
21
18
19
20
21
22
2-94
Importing Scientific Data Files
Alternatively, you can specify the specific field in the structure returned by
hdfinfo
that contains this information. For example, to read a scientific
data set, use the
SDS
field.
dset = hdfread(info.SDS);
Reading a Subset of the Data in a Data Set
To read a subset of a data set, you can use the optional
'index'
parameter.
The value of the index parameter is a cell array of three vectors that specify
the location in the data set to start reading, the skip interval (e.g., read every
other data item), and the amount of data to read (e.g., the length along each
dimension). In HDF4 terminology, these parameters are called the start,
stride, and edge values.
For example, this code
• Starts reading data at the third row, third column (
[3 3]
).
• Reads every element in the array (
[]
).
• Reads 10 rows and 2 columns (
[10 2]
).
subset = hdfread('Example.hdf','Example SDS',...
'Index',{[3 3],[],[10 2 ]})
subset =
7
8
8
9
9
10
10
11
11
12
12
13
13
14
14
15
15
16
16
17
2-95
2
Importing Data
Using the HDF4 Low-Level Functions
This section describes how to use MATLAB functions to access the HDF4
Application Programming Interfaces (APIs). These APIs are libraries of C
routines. To import or export data, you must use the functions in the HDF4
API associated with the particular HDF4 data type you are working with.
Each API has a particular programming model, that is, a prescribed way
to use the routines to write data sets to the file. To illustrate this concept,
this section describes the programming model of one particular HDF4 API:
the HDF4 Scientific Data (SD) API. For a complete list of the HDF4 APIs
supported by MATLAB and the functions you use to access each one, see
the
hdf
reference page.
Note This section does not attempt to describe all HDF4 features and
routines. To use the MATLAB HDF4 functions effectively, you must refer to
the official NCSA documentation at the HDF Web site (
www.hdfgroup.org
).
This section includes the following:
• “Mapping HDF4 to MATLAB Syntax” on page 2-96
• “Step 1: Opening the HDF4 File” on page 2-97
• “Step 2: Retrieving Information About the HDF4 File” on page 2-98
• “Step 3: Retrieving Attributes from an HDF4 File (Optional)” on page 2-99
• “Step 4: Selecting the Data Sets to Import” on page 2-100
• “Step 5: Getting Information About a Data Set” on page 2-100
• “Step 6: Reading Data from the HDF4 File” on page 2-101
• “Step 7: Closing the HDF4 Data Set” on page 2-102
• “Step 8: Closing the HDF4 File” on page 2-103
Mapping HDF4 to MATLAB Syntax. Each HDF4 API includes many
individual routines that you use to read data from files, write data to files,
and perform other related functions. For example, the HDF4 Scientific Data
(SD) API includes separate C routines to open (
SDopen
), close (
SDend)
,and
read data (
SDreaddata
).
2-96
Documents you may be interested
Documents you may be interested